ALEXANDRIA, Va., Nov. 25 -- United States Patent no. 12,479,769, issued on Nov. 25, was assigned to Canon K.K. (Tokyo).

"Inorganic material powder and method of manufacturing a structural body" was invented by Hiroshi Saito (Kanagawa, Japan), Yasuhiro Sekine (Kanagawa, Japan), Nobuhiro Yasui (Kanagawa, Japan) and Kanako Oshima (Tokyo).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"To achieve local melting of an inorganic material powder containing an inorganic material as a main component in an additive manufacturing technology, to thereby achieve high shaping accuracy.
